of 22 St Ann's Square, Manchester

c.1864 National Boiler Insurance Co established

1866 Designation of patent from John Smith to National Boiler[1]

1877 Plug patent: Mr Hiller[2]

1882 Advert: Henry Hiller was Chief Engineer and Manager; advertised patent fusible plug.

1883/4 Designation of patent re invention for improvement of fusible plugs; from John Kenyon to National Boiler[3]

1894 Advert: Name had become National Boiler and General Insurance Company .
